Transaction 59bbd6f798d481c6bdff7d28d3b9e62e428f52abec93f181d5698c0527851fbb
1 Input
1 Output
-
59bbd6f798d481c6bdff7d28d3b9e62e428f52abec93f181d5698c0527851fbb:0
- value
- 21149423
- script pubkey
- OP_0 OP_PUSHBYTES_20 9fdca6ae9e10643b9a9493ff49f3ae391d14541d
- address
- bc1qnlw2dt57zpjrhx55j0l5nuaw8yw3g4qa6ytews